      <title>Setting TMPDIR in Maya.env is not working</title>
      <link>https://forums.autodesk.com/t5/maya-forum/setting-tmpdir-in-maya-env-is-not-working/m-p/9655711#M16133</link>
      <description>&lt;P&gt;Hi!&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I've edited the &lt;STRONG&gt;Maya.env&lt;/STRONG&gt; file in&amp;nbsp;~/Library/Preferences/Autodesk/maya/2020&amp;nbsp;and added: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;FONT face="andale mono,times"&gt;TMPDIR = '/Volumes/NVMe Array/Caches'&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;After restarting Maya and using the &lt;FONT face="andale mono,times"&gt;getenv 'TMPDIR'&lt;/FONT&gt; command, the variable has not been changed.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I also tried setting the variable in Maya using &lt;FONT face="andale mono,times"&gt;putenv 'TMPDIR' '/Volumes/NVMe Array/Caches'&lt;/FONT&gt;. Then, getenv DOES return the new path until I restart Maya, then the path has reverted to the default again.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Does anyone know why this is happening?&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I'm using Maya 2020 on macOS 10.15.6&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;Also, I have confirmed that the Maya.env file &lt;EM&gt;is&lt;/EM&gt; being picked up by Maya.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I added a random variable &lt;FONT face="andale mono,times"&gt;TEST=testing&lt;/FONT&gt; to Maya.env and after loading Maya, &lt;FONT face="andale mono,times"&gt;getenv TEST&lt;/FONT&gt; &lt;EM&gt;does&lt;/EM&gt; return &lt;FONT face="andale mono,times"&gt;testing&lt;/FONT&gt;. So, the issue seems to be only with the &lt;FONT face="andale mono,times"&gt;TMPDIR&lt;/FONT&gt; environment variable.&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;I just found this&lt;/STRONG&gt; in&amp;nbsp;&lt;A href="https://knowledge.autodesk.com/support/maya/learn-explore/caas/CloudHelp/cloudhelp/2020/ENU/Maya-EnvVar/files/GUID-1D8B1A57-6FA3-4494-8FEC-87DA2A38FD35-htm.html" target="_blank" rel="noopener"&gt;Setting environment variables using system commands&lt;/A&gt;: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;FONT color="#FF0000"&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;"The variables set in the operating system take priority over any settings in the Maya.env file."&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;So, apparently, since &lt;FONT face="andale mono,times"&gt;TMPDIR&lt;/FONT&gt; is&amp;nbsp;already set on macOS somewhere in&amp;nbsp;/var/folders/ I can't&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;override it.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;How, then, do I make Maya store its temporary files in another location without changing &lt;FONT face="andale mono,times"&gt;TMPDIR&lt;/FONT&gt; at the system level?&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;&lt;FONT size="5"&gt;The solution to this is to &lt;STRONG&gt;run Maya from the command line&lt;/STRONG&gt;.&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;A convenient approach is to create an alias in your .bash_profile (or similar) that sets the TMPDIR variable and runs the Maya executable: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;LI-CODE lang="general"&gt;alias maya="TMPDIR=path/to/temp /Applications/Autodesk/maya2020/Maya.app/Contents/bin/maya"&lt;/LI-CODE&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;The first part of the alias, "TMPDIR=path/to/temp", sets the path to the new temporary folder.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;The second part is the command "/Applications/Autodesk/maya2020/Maya.app/Contents/bin/maya" that opens Maya. Note that it is the path to the maya binary for version 2020. Adjust the version number as needed.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;This approach &lt;STRONG&gt;leaves the default TMPDIR value unchanged&lt;/STRONG&gt; for other applications and sets a new value in a separate process just for the instance of Maya that it's running.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
